#30b590 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#30b590 is composed of 18.8% red, 71% green and 56.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 20.4%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 163.3 degrees, a saturation of 58.1% and a lightness of 44.9%. #30b590 color hex could be obtained by blending #60ffff with #006b21.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

● #30b590 color description : Moderate cyan - lime green.
#30b590 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#30b590 has RGB values of R:48, G:181, B:144 and CMYK values of C:0.73, M:0, Y:0.2,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 3192208.

Shades and Tints of #30b590
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030a08 is the darkest color, while #fafef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#30b590
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6e7775 is the less saturated color, while #04e1a4 is the most saturated one.
